Regus Opens First Dual-Licence Workspace In Dubai To Serve Both On-Shore And Free Aone Businesses

With the UAE’s continued economic growth driving demand for flexible, convenient and connected work space solutions, leading global workspace provider Regus has opened its first dual-licence business centre in Dubai serving both free zone and on-shore Dubai licence holders.

Centrally located in the Dubai World Trade Centre – the region’s largest purpose-built complex for events and exhibitions – the new centre offers a prestigious address for businesses, whether start-ups, small or medium-sized enterprises or multinational corporations. Workspace options include private offices, co-sharing workspaces, a variety of meeting rooms, and full connectivity, thanks to state-of-the-art technology services.

The official opening of the new Regus centre was conducted in the presence of Dubai World Trade Centre Vice President Abdalla Al Banna and Dubai Economic Department Directors Walid Abdul Malik Ahli and Khalid El Fahim, and a number of VIP guests.
